In reference to reproduction, what does CL stand for? Correct Answer Corpus Luteum

The corpus luteum is a temporary endocrine structure involved in ovulation and early pregnancy. During ovulation, the primary follicle leads to the formation of the secondary follicle and subsequently the mature vesicular follicle. At ovulation, the follicle ruptures expelling the ovum into the fallopian tube.
